High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les Allan Sherman (November 30, 1924 - November 20, 1973) was an American comedy writer and television producer who became famous as a song parodist in the early 1960s. His first album, My Son, the Folk Singer (1962), became the fastest-selling record album up to that time. His biggest hit single was "Hello Muddah, Hello Faddah," a comic novelty in which a boy describes his summer camp experiences to the tune of Ponchielli's Dance of the Hours.
